He was drafted by the Houston Texans in the second round of the 2002 NFL Draft. He played college football at Florida.
Gaffney has also been a member of the the Philadelphia Eagles and New England Patriots.

He is the son of former New York Jets wide receiver Derrick Gaffney and the cousin of current Philadelphia Eagles cornerback Lito Sheppard.
Early years
Gaffney attended William M. Raines High School in Jacksonville, Florida, and was a student and a letterman in football.

In football, he was a two-year starter as a wide receiver and as a junior, he led his team to a State Title.
Professional career
Houston Texans
Gaffney was selected with the 1st pick in the 2nd round of the 2002 NFL Draft by the Houston Texans. His tenure with the team was marred by his often inconsistent play which led to his benching in favor of veterans receivers, in particular Corey Bradford.

New England Patriots
On October 9, 2006, Gaffney signed a two-year deal with the Patriots. On March 5, 2008, Gaffney re-signed with the Patriots for one year worth $2 million.
In his first-ever playoff game, on January 7, 2007 against the New York Jets, Gaffney had a near-career day, catching eight passes for 104 yards, his second 100-yard performance as a receiver (in ten regular season games, Gaffney caught 11 passes for 142 yards and one touchdown.) Gaffney followed that performance a week later against San Diego with another 100-yard game, in which he caught ten passes and scored a touchdown.
Jabar Gaffney finished the 2008 season with 44 receptions for 468 yards and two touchdowns.
